Transaction e32a8301ebf712df0d7dfb02d60bf05e079262e15ceb670fbc8954925d3b28de
1 Input
1 Output
-
e32a8301ebf712df0d7dfb02d60bf05e079262e15ceb670fbc8954925d3b28de:0
- value
- 53224542
- script pubkey
- OP_0 OP_PUSHBYTES_20 90638b3e0dffe4cc29faab2310c24c3b9580abcf
- address
- bc1qjp3ck0sdlljvc2064v33psjv8w2cp270phk57k